Friday, August 23,2024 - Many Kenyans led by Kileleshwa Ward MCA, Robert Alai, have been questioning whether Narc Kenya Chairperson, Martha Karua, has a valid license to practise as a lawyer after she was seen in court defending businessman Jimmy Wanjigi on Tuesday.

A quick search on the Law Society of Kenya (LSK) website shows that her practising status is active with a certificate in issue for this year.

Alai and some pro-Government bloggers had on Wednesday morning taken to social media castigating the LSK for allegedly allowing some advocates to practice without a license.

"How do you force young men and women to pay for practising certificates while Martha Karua and Eugene Wamalwa who have all been part of the cog can’t pay for theirs?” read his statement in part.

But as the search revealed, Karua’s status is active.

Section 9 of the Advocates Practice Rules states that no person shall be qualified to act as an advocate unless he has in place a Practising Certificate (PC).

It is the Practising Certificate that entitles the advocate to become a member of the LSK and to practice law in the country.

It is to be taken every year.
